Wolfe guided the Phoenix to a stellar week with a pair of sweeps and led the attack with some astronomical numbers. The 6-4 rookie totaled 32 kills and hit .419 over the six sets. In Sunday's opener with Hilbert, Wolfe was nothing but super as he put down 21 kills on just 32 attempts with no errors for a hitting percentage of .656. The 21 kills are tied for third for most in a three-set match in Division III while his .656 attack rate is sixth nationally for hitting percentage with a minimum of 20 attempts in a single match. Wolfe followed up with 11 kills in a sweep of Hood to avenge a five-set defeat at the hands of the Blazers last week. Defensively he was solid as well as he picked up eight digs and made five blocks, four of which came against Hood.
This is the first Player of the Week award for Wolfe in his career.
